Job Description:

Major Responsibilities:

Assists with basic care for patients in the areas of nutrition, elimination, comfort, mobility and safety.Transports and transfers patients within the medical complex using appropriate equipment (ex. LIKO ceiling lifts) and utilizing safety precautions as indicated by the patient's health status.Assists nursing staff in lifting and ambulating patients using appropriate practice guidelines.Transports bodies to the morgue. Maintains environment and equipment and will locate and deliver appropriate equipment to Central Service and Maintenance departments.Works collaboratively with the health care team members to effectively communicate and document accurate information.Demonstrates dependability, organizational skills and effective use of time by setting priorities to complete delegated work within established time frames in accordance with unit CBO/P and unit guidelines.Demonstrates role accountability by adhering to Gundersen Health System Mission statement, policies and confidentiality standards.Assists in the orientation of new personnel.Participates in quality improvement activities in order to continuously improve patient care and unit operations.Participates in CNA meetings and unit staff meetings.Adheres to regular and predictable attendance.Personally interacts, engages with and cares for patients.Ensures patient safety.
